JUSTICE ANIL KUMAR UPADHYAY ORAL JUDGMENT Date : 31-08-2018 Earlier this case was dismissed for non-prosecution on 12.09.2013. The writ petition was restored vide order dated 17.01.2017 in MJC No. 5592 of 2013. Thereafter the case was listed on different dates andno one had appeared on behalf of the petitioner. Under the aforesaid circumstances, the case has been listed today under the heading "For Dismissal" but unfortunately, no one has appeared on behalf of the petitioner even today. It is to be noted here that on 22.11.2017 submission was made on behalf of the petitioner that the similar issue is involved in SLP (Civil) No. 4025 of 2014, which is pending before the
Patna High Court CWJC No.17318 of 2013 dt.31-08-2018 2/2 Supreme Court and as such the case was directed to be listed after disposal of the said SLP. It appears that SLP (C ) No. 4025 of 2014 has been finally dismissed on 23.02.2018.
Since no one has been appearing on behalf of the petitioner for the last several dates and even today no one has appeared and in view of the fact that the SLP (C ) No. 4025 of 2014, on which the petitioner has placed reliance, as is evident from the order dated 22.11.2017, has been dismissed by the Apex Court, the present writ petition does not merit any consideration. In view of the dismissal of SLP © No. 4025 of 2014 (Upendra Singh Vs. The State of Bihar & Ors.), the present writ petition is dismissed.
